Softball Preview: Sunlake Seahawks vs. East Lake Eagles

The Sunlake Seahawks will challenge the East Lake Eagles at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The two teams each escaped (but just barely!) with wins against their previous opponents.

Sunlake is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Monday. They had just enough and edged Sickles out 3-2. Three seems to be a good number for Sunlake as the team scooped up a victory with the same number of runs in their previous game.

Mia Fields made a big impact no matter where she played. On the mound, she struck out six batters over seven innings while giving up just one earned (and one unearned) run off four hits. Fields has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't pitched less than five innings in five consecutive pitching appearances. Fields was also stellar in the batter's box, going 2-for-3 with a home run and two RBI.

Fields wasn't the only one making solid contact as four players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Marissa Martinez, who scored a run while going 1-for-4.

Meanwhile, East Lake had already won six in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 8.8 runs), and they went ahead and made it seven on Friday. They came out on top in a nail-biter against the Buccaneers and snuck past 4-3.

Like Sunlake, East Lake also got a great game from a two-way player: Lucy Mondok. She pitched seven inn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off four hits. Mondok was also big at the plate, going 1-for-4 with a home run and two RBI.

Sunlake is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 17-9 record this season. As for East Lake, their win was their fifth stra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 21-2.
